diff --git a/src/xenia/cpu/ppc/ppc_opcode_disasm.cc b/src/xenia/cpu/ppc/ppc_opcode_disasm.cc index 173f89442..58742fbf7 100644 --- a/src/xenia/cpu/ppc/ppc_opcode_disasm.cc +++ b/src/xenia/cpu/ppc/ppc_opcode_disasm.cc @@ -1689,9 +1689,9 @@ void PrintDisasm_mtmsrd(const PPCDecodeData& d, StringBuffer* str) { str->AppendFormat("r%d", d.X.RS()); } void PrintDisasm_mtspr(const PPCDecodeData& d, StringBuffer* str) { - // mtmspr [SPR], [RS] + // mtspr [SPR], [RS] size_t str_start = str->length(); - str->Append("mtmspr"); + str->Append("mtspr"); PadStringBuffer(str, str_start, kNamePad); str->AppendFormat("%d", d.XFX.SPR()); str->Append(", "); diff --git a/tools/ppc-instructions.xml b/tools/ppc-instructions.xml index 2288d75ac..e8c5e2837 100644 --- a/tools/ppc-instructions.xml +++ b/tools/ppc-instructions.xml @@ -908,7 +908,7 @@ - mtmspr [SPR], [RS] + mtspr [SPR], [RS]